Overview

The podcast explores the shifting responsibilities of testers in modern software development, stressing the need for them to take on more proactive and influential roles. It underscores the importance of thought leadership, collaboration with engineering teams, and effective communication as key tools for driving positive change and ensuring quality is prioritized from the start of a project. Testers are encouraged to step beyond traditional testing duties and engage more deeply in development processes, questioning outdated practices and promoting quality-aware approaches.

The discussion also covers the role of AI in testing, acknowledging its potential to streamline repetitive tasks but emphasizing the irreplaceable role of human judgment in evaluating user experience, emotional intelligence, and subjective quality factors. Furthermore, it highlights the benefits of diverse team roles, the value of coaching and career growth, and the need to dismantle organizational silos to foster better collaboration and more successful outcomes. The episode aims to guide and inspire testers to expand their influence and adapt to the evolving field of software testing.
